Wasn’t prepared otherwise I would have taken more pics. Early this morning I was cleaning up after installing front end spring spacers.

The largest Milwaukee Packout fits under a flush mounted hard tri-fold. It contains all Dewalt {vacuum, blower, multiple lights, chainsaw, bar & chain oil, extra chain, ratchet, atomic 1/2” impact, drill and grinder} tool roll with hand tools, oil mat, a zip tie or two…bla bla bla

I have a Bubba rope bag with 2 tree straps, kinetic rope, D-rings and soft shackles. Another bag with rags and blanket. Diesel treatment and assorted car care products along with a heavy duty folding chair.
